Effects of methandienone on the performance and body composition of men undergoing athletic training.

作者信息

Hervey G R, Knibbs A V, Burkinshaw L, Morgan D B, Jones P R, Chettle D R, Vartsky D

出版信息

Clin Sci (Lond). 1981 Apr;60(4):457-61. doi: 10.1042/cs0600457.

Abstract
  1. In a previous study of the effects of methandienone (Dianabol) on men undergoing athletic training, strength and performance increased, but not significantly more when the subjects were taking the drug than when they were taking placebo. The subjects did, however, gain more weight on the drug, with increases in total body potassium and muscle dimensions. It remained an open question whether the muscles had gained normal tissue or intracellular fluid. 2. In an attempt to distinguish between these possibilities the trial has been repeated, using as subjects seven male weight-lifters in regular training, and including measurements of total body nitrogen. As before, a dose of 100 mg of methandienone/day was given alternately with the placebo in a double-blind crossover experiment. The treatment periods lasted 6 weeks and were separated by an interval of 6 weeks. Body weight, potassium and nitrogen, muscle size, and leg performance and strength increased significantly during training on the drug, but not during the placebo period. 3. The finding of increased body nitrogen suggested that the weight gain was not only intracellular fluid. The increases in body potassium (436 +/- SEM 41 mmol) and nitrogen (255 +/- 69 g) were too large in proportion to the weight gain (2.3 +/- 0.4 kg) for this to be attributed to gain of normal muscle or other lean tissue, and imply gain of nitrogen-rich, phosphate-poor substance. Although this action of methandienone might be described as anabolic, the weight gain produced is not normal muscle.
摘要
  1. 在先前一项关于美雄酮(大力补)对接受运动训练男性影响的研究中,力量和表现有所提高,但服用该药物的受试者与服用安慰剂的受试者相比,提高幅度并不显著。然而,服用该药物的受试者体重增加更多,全身钾含量和肌肉尺寸也有所增加。肌肉增加的是正常组织还是细胞内液仍是一个悬而未决的问题。2. 为了区分这些可能性,该试验得以重复进行,以七名经常进行训练的男性举重运动员为受试者,并测量了全身氮含量。和之前一样,在双盲交叉实验中,每天交替给予100毫克美雄酮和安慰剂。治疗期持续6周,中间间隔6周。在服用药物训练期间,体重、钾、氮、肌肉大小以及腿部表现和力量显著增加,而在服用安慰剂期间则没有增加。3. 全身氮含量增加的结果表明,体重增加不仅仅是细胞内液增加。全身钾(436±标准误41毫摩尔)和氮(255±69克)的增加与体重增加(2.3±0.4千克)相比比例过大,以至于不能将其归因于正常肌肉或其他瘦组织的增加,这意味着增加的是富含氮、贫磷的物质。尽管美雄酮的这种作用可被描述为合成代谢,但所产生的体重增加并非正常肌肉。
